Frequently Asked Questions about Southwest Chicago

How much are Studio apartments in Southwest Chicago?

There are currently 2,576 Studio Apartments in Southwest Chicago with rent ranges from $575 to $4,011 with an average price of $1,809.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Southwest Chicago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Southwest Chicago ranges from $650 to $15,732 with an average monthly rent of $2,314.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Southwest Chicago c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Southwest Chicago range from $850 to $14,517.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,524.

How expensive are Southwest Chicago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 1,871 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Southwest Chicago on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$800 to $16,745 - averaging $2,656 for the location.
